About this calvados:
This exceptional calvados comes from the protected cru Domfrontais, an area where the calvados must undergo at least 3 years of cask aging. The base for this calvados is a unique cider, composed of about 60% pear and 40% apple - well above the required 30% pear that the Domfrontais appellation prescribes. During our visit to the domain, it turned out to be the oldest cask in their possession. About the producer:
In the lush Touques Valley in Pont-l'Eveque, amidst the Pays d'Auge with authentic architecture, you will find a true gem of French distilling art: the family distillery Christian Drouin. For three generations, this beautiful 17th-century farm has told the story of passion, craftsmanship, and tradition in the world of Calvados, cider, and Pommeau de Normandie. Established in 1960, the first calvados was commercialized in 1979. Around the characteristic domain stand stately high-stem apple trees carrying no less than 25 different types of cider apples. This traditional, intensive cultivation method reflects the dedication to authenticity that is so characteristic of the house Drouin. The production takes place not only here but also on the historic farm in Gonneville-sur-Honfleur and extends to their cellar in Domfront. Christian Drouin is not only a producer but also a 'Negociant-Eleveur'. This is a trader who specializes in aging eaux-de-vie to bottle and market them later. This type of negociant buys both young and old Calvados from other small local producers, with the emphasis on aging under his own care, in his own cellar, with his own oak policy, etc. Christian Drouin is located just 15 minutes from Deauville and 20 minutes from the picturesque Honfleur.
Tasting notes:
Nose: Very complex and overripe high-stem fruit with a tropical warmth and length.
Taste: Syrup from Vrolingen (old apple syrup) with a very oily structure. Lovely balance between complexity and age. Polished cedar wood, candied fruit, and black tea from Mozambique with dried apple.
Finish: Very long and complex, pear compote and nutty with light spices.
